3. File System Choice

The selection of a file system is a pivotal determination within the strategy of formatting an SD card, immediately impacting its usability and compatibility throughout the Android ecosystem. The choice is just not arbitrary; it determines how knowledge is saved, organized, and accessed on the storage medium. Understanding the nuances of file system choice is essential for successfully getting ready an SD card.

  • FAT32 Benefits and Limitations

    FAT32, whereas a long-standing file system, provides broad compatibility with quite a few units past Android, together with older working programs, digital cameras, and embedded programs. Its major limitation lies in its incapacity to help particular person recordsdata bigger than 4GB. This restriction could also be important if the SD card is meant for storing high-resolution movies or massive knowledge archives. Choosing FAT32 is usually pushed by a necessity for cross-platform performance, even on the expense of dealing with very massive single recordsdata. Within the context of formatting on Android, the provision of FAT32 as an choice depends upon the Android model and the formatting software getting used.

  • exFAT as an Different

    exFAT presents itself as a contemporary various to FAT32, overcoming the 4GB file measurement limitation. It retains a excessive diploma of compatibility throughout completely different working programs, although not as universally as FAT32. Newer Android units usually help exFAT, enabling the storage of huge media recordsdata with out constraints. When formatting on an Android system, selecting exFAT supplies an answer for customers who must retailer recordsdata exceeding the FAT32 restrict, assuming the system and goal units are suitable.

  • NTFS Concerns

    NTFS, primarily utilized by Home windows working programs, provides superior options equivalent to file permissions and journaling. Nonetheless, native help for NTFS on Android is proscribed. Whereas some Android units could learn NTFS formatted playing cards, writing capabilities are sometimes absent or require third-party functions. Subsequently, deciding on NTFS when formatting an SD card supposed for Android use is mostly discouraged, except particular functions or root entry are utilized to allow full NTFS help.

  • Impression on Efficiency

    The chosen file system can affect the learn and write speeds of the SD card on an Android system. FAT32, resulting from its easier construction, could exhibit barely quicker efficiency for smaller recordsdata in comparison with exFAT on some older programs. Nonetheless, with bigger recordsdata or newer Android units, exFAT typically supplies superior efficiency resulting from its optimized structure. Benchmarking the SD card after formatting with completely different file programs might help decide probably the most environment friendly selection for a selected use case.

4. Storage Capability Limits

The storage capability of an SD card immediately influences the feasibility and technique of formatting it utilizing the FAT32 file system. The inherent limitations of FAT32 current issues that have to be addressed throughout the formatting course of, significantly when coping with bigger capability playing cards.

  • 32GB Barrier

    The FAT32 file system is mostly restricted to a most partition measurement of 32GB when utilizing commonplace formatting instruments throughout the Home windows working system. Whereas technically FAT32 can help bigger volumes, these are sometimes formatted with various file programs by default. When formatting an SD card on Android, it’s essential to grasp how the Android formatting utility handles playing cards exceeding this capability. Some Android implementations could refuse to format playing cards bigger than 32GB to FAT32, necessitating the usage of third-party formatting functions or procedures carried out on a pc.

  • Compatibility Concerns with Massive Playing cards

    Even when an SD card bigger than 32GB is efficiently formatted to FAT32 utilizing various strategies, compatibility points could come up. Older units, together with sure Android telephones and tablets, won’t correctly acknowledge or make the most of your complete storage capability of such a card. This may end up in the system reporting incorrect cupboard space or encountering errors when trying to learn or write knowledge past the 32GB mark. Subsequently, customers ought to confirm compatibility with their particular units earlier than utilizing large-capacity FAT32 formatted SD playing cards.

  • Cluster Measurement Implications

    The cluster measurement, representing the smallest unit of cupboard space allotted to a file, is a vital parameter in FAT32 formatting. Bigger SD playing cards could profit from bigger cluster sizes to enhance efficiency and scale back file system overhead. Nonetheless, excessively massive cluster sizes can result in wasted cupboard space, significantly when storing quite a few small recordsdata. Optimizing the cluster measurement is important for environment friendly storage utilization, particularly when formatting bigger SD playing cards to FAT32. Some formatting instruments present choices for specifying the cluster measurement, permitting for fine-tuning based mostly on the supposed use case.

  • Different File System Suggestions

    For SD playing cards considerably exceeding 32GB, the exFAT file system typically supplies a extra sensible various. ExFAT overcomes the file measurement and partition measurement limitations of FAT32 whereas retaining broad compatibility with trendy units. Android units usually help exFAT, making it a viable choice for formatting large-capacity SD playing cards used for storing high-resolution media recordsdata or different massive knowledge units. If the SD card is primarily supposed to be used with Android units that help exFAT, deciding on this file system can remove the constraints related to FAT32.

Incessantly Requested Questions

The next questions and solutions tackle widespread issues concerning the method of getting ready an SD card with the FAT32 file system to be used on Android units.

Query 1: Is formatting an SD card to FAT32 on Android mandatory for all SD playing cards?

Formatting to FAT32 is just not universally required. Newer Android units typically help various file programs equivalent to exFAT, which overcome limitations of FAT32. Nonetheless, FAT32 stays related for older units or when cross-platform compatibility is a precedence.

Query 2: What potential dangers are related to formatting an SD card?

The formatting course of erases all knowledge on the SD card. Insufficient backups may end up in everlasting knowledge loss. Moreover, improper formatting procedures can render the SD card unusable.

Query 3: Can an SD card bigger than 32GB be formatted to FAT32 on Android?

Whereas technically possible, formatting SD playing cards bigger than 32GB to FAT32 could require third-party functions or computer-based formatting instruments. Android’s built-in formatting utilities could impose limitations on bigger capacities.

Query 4: What are the constraints of the FAT32 file system?

FAT32’s major limitation is its incapacity to help particular person recordsdata bigger than 4GB. It might additionally exhibit efficiency constraints in comparison with newer file programs when dealing with very massive recordsdata.

Query 5: How can the file system of a at present formatted SD card be decided?

Connecting the SD card to a pc and analyzing its properties throughout the working system’s file explorer or disk administration utility will reveal the file system kind.

Query 6: What actions ought to be taken if an Android system doesn’t acknowledge a FAT32 formatted SD card?

Confirm that the SD card is correctly inserted and free from bodily harm. Make sure the Android system helps the SD card’s capability and file system. If the difficulty persists, try and format the SD card utilizing a unique formatting software or system.
